The Carbon market in Africa has been largely operating below its potential in previous years with most projects revolving only around clean cooking devices. In 2023, at the Africa Climate Summit in Kenya, $250 million was committed by UAE to purchase quality carbon credits from Africa. The potential for the Africa Carbon Market is set to increase in coming years with more commitment of funds. Chemotronix has submitted some of its projects to the African Carbon Market Initiative (ACMI) which have been approved. Our solution utilizes a digital monitoring, reporting and verification (dMRV) system to ensure effective offset of carbon emissions. This will help us to monitor our progress towards achieving net zero.
The Chemotronix IoT device collects data from IoT devices using various
sensors and a microcontroller. The sensors include the MG811 and
MQ135 for measuring carbon dioxide levels, the MQ7 and MQ9 for
measuring carbon monoxide levels, and the BME280 for measuring
humidity and temperature.
The data collected from the sensors are processed and stored using the
InterPlanetary File System (IPFS) with Web3.storage & Co2.storage by
Filecoin as the decentralized storage service provider. The data is curated
to remove irrelevant information, formatted to a suitable format, and
reduced in size to optimize storage.
We also have laid out plans to harness remote sensing techniques and
satellite data with the motive of combining them with other open source
carbon emissions data for advanced analytics.

At Chemotronix we develop carbon credit projects (Solar Agri photovoltaic Farms, Biogas and Hydrogen) to various rural communities in Africa for energy, technological and industrial companies to offset their emissions while they transition towards clean energy sources.
We offer sales of carbon credits at $5/tCO2e, low cost ioT devices for monitoring at $40/ device and energy supply to households at $50-100/month. We also have huge prospects of revenue to be generated from the sales of agricultural products harvested from our project locations.
